Stock Trend Prediction Using News Sentiment Analysis
Prediction and analysis of the stock market have an important role in today’s economy. The decision to buy or sell shares in the stock market is a challenging task for investors. Different linear (AR, MA, autoregressive integrated moving average (ARIMA), and ARMA) and nonlinear models (ARCH, GARCH, and neural network) have been developed for stock forecasting. However, successful stock market prediction is still difficult. Different factors influence stock market movement, including news articles and social media data. Our proposed method integrates news sentiment scores into a statistical prediction model (BST) to identify the influence of news sentiment on stock market movement and forecast volatile stock trends more accurately
